I have a 1997 Plymouth Breeze, and the fuse panel can be seen when you open the driver's side door, at the end of the dashboard. It is normally covered up by the door when it's closed, so you need to leave the door open to see it. Lift off the panel, (may have to tug a bit).

THE FUSE FOR THE HORN ON A 1996 PLYMOUTH NEON IS LOCATED UNDER THE HOOD.THERE IS A BLACK PLASTIC BOX ON LEFT END OF THE ENGINE. THAT IS THE FUSE BOX.THE IS A FUSE BOX THAT CONTAINS FUSES AND RELAYS. ON THE INSIDE OF THE LID IS A DIAGRAM SHOWING THE LOCATION OF THE INDIVUAL FUSES AND RELAYS. .
